Headings element describes the topic of the section it introduces. Heading information helps user, tools to understand contents of the document automatically.

HTML Headings

Headings are defined with the <h1> to <h6> tags.

<h1> defines the most important heading. <h6> defines the least important heading.


<h1>This is a heading</h1>
<h3>This is a heading</h3>
<h4>This is a heading</h4>

Note: Browsers automatically add some empty space (a margin) before and after each heading.

Headings Are Important

  • Use HTML headings for headings only. Don't use headings to make text BIG or bold.
  • Search engines use your headings to index the structure and content of your web pages.
  • Users skim your pages by its headings. It is important to use headings to show the document structure.
  • h1 headings should be main headings, followed by h3 headings, then the less important h4, and so on.

HTML Horizontal Rules

The <hr> tag creates a horizontal line in an HTML page.

The hr element can be used to separate content:


<p>This is a paragraph.</p><hr>
<p>This is a paragraph.</p><hr>
<p>This is a paragraph.</p>


